I’ve been a wildlife artist as long as I can remember. My first success as an artist began at the age of 16, when I won Kentucky’s first Junior Duck Stamp art contest. My winning entry, Pin Stripes, of a pintail duck on rippled (striped) water, toured the country in a traveling exhibit alongside the other first place winning paintings from each of the fifty states. I had business cards made and received my first Kentucky sales tax identification number for the sale of my art that year.

Today, I am still influenced by the animals that I come across while hiking, hunting, and bird watching.
